Corporate Claims Manager

JOB SUMMARY:

The successful management of all claims falling under the property and casualty worldwide risk management program.

Establishes the development and management of training programs devoted to reducing the frequency and severity of claims. Creates and maintains a liaison with field operations to ensure claims management and execution of early return to work programs as respects work-related injuries/workers’ compensation programs. Rolls out the training programs at a train-the-trainer level to HR field management responsible for execution of the early return to work and claim management programs. Manages and negotiates contracts with external vendors e.g., third-party claim administrators, defense counsel and medical provider networks. Ensures 3rd party vendors deliver high levels of customer services that result in improved performance and overall results.

  • Manage claim evaluation and resolution process on all workers’ compensation, automobile, general liability and property claims. Lead semi-annual claim reviews with all Third-Party Claim Administrators on open claims reserved at >$10,000 and include HR/LP field operations participation when appropriate. Daily claims management and settlement authorization of workers’ compensation, third-party and auto liability claims including litigated claims and management of defense counsel. Liaison field personnel with defense counsel when necessary and oversee corporate responses to discovery/document requests. Lead all claim evaluations, inclusive of litigation strategies, settlement valuation and appropriateness of reserves and communicate directly with insurers on any/all large loss claims. Manage and direct the TPA relationship, holding them accountable for delivery on program initiatives and demonstrating results.
  • Drive field responsibility to claims management processes and procedures to achieve the most favorable claims outcome possible. Use monthly/quarterly SBU specific reporting initiatives and related communications e.g., teleconferences or meetings during field corporate visits, to manage field execution as needed. Identify and evaluate additional opportunities to further reduce the severity and cost of casualty and property claims.
  • Lead and direct claims management process, driving execution of best practices and related initiatives to reduce cost of claims, affect claim closures and provide field education/awareness. Provide guidance and strategic input on claims management activities for workers’ compensation, automobile, general liability property and in-house third-party claims yielding positive results.
  • Monitor existing programs and make changes as appropriate. Responsible to write policies, practices, procedures and training modules for claim management programs. Communicate changes / enhancements to the field operators
  • Statutory working knowledge of workers compensation laws. Ongoing education to keep apprised of regulatory/legal changes that may affect and/or impact program(s) and effect change when necessary.
  • Partner with the Risk Manager to provide guidance and analysis to legal department and or corporate departments on contractual issues involving insurance coverage and related matters. Participate in contract negotiation conference calls and contract review meetings specific to insurance coverage concerns and risk transfer options e.g., indemnification clauses. Assist the Risk Manager in updating the insurance reference guidelines annually or as needed.

 

 

 

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or Degree Required
  • Certificates/Licenses: Associate in Risk Management or Claim Management Designation
  • 8 to 10 years related work experience
  • Ability to evaluate settlement value of property and casualty claims. Requires interpretation of physicians’ medical reports and correlation of injury to work relationship. Third-party claims require ability to evaluate issues relative to negligence of involved parties, etc. Ability to communicate legal issues with defense counsel.
  • Strong negotiation skills
  • Leadership and managerial skills
  • Effective communication skills both written/verbal
  • Computer literacy: TPA Claim Database, Global Risk Advantage or similar experience. Microsoft, Word, Excel and PowerPoint
  • Good business sense
